Chapter 1: Return to Equestria
I'm Phoenix Wright, ace defense attorney and the proprietor of the Wright Anything Agency. We're primarily a law office, with two other defense attorneys besides myself on retainer, but we've been known to dabble in a few side projects, such as my adopted daughter, Trucy's, magic shows. Nearly nine years ago, we used to be called the Wright & Co. Law Office. I was the sole lawyer, supported by Maya Fey, a spirit medium of the Kurain tradition, as well as the sister of my mentor. None of my cases could be considered normal or average, but compared to the one I was quite literally summoned for, most of them could be considered downright pedestrian. This all started with that case...
??????? ???????
June 9th, 9:45 PM
"Ugh..." Feels like I just got hit with a ton of bricks...
"Hey! Who the heck are you?!"
(...Who's voice is that?)
"For that matter WHAT the heck are you?"
("What am I?" What kind of question is that? Does she mean my profession?)
"I wanted the best defense attorney in Equestria, not some... porcupine thing."
(*Sigh* Does my hair really look like a porcupine... my muscles are coming to, I think I can open my eyes.) Opening them, I was greeted by the sight of a colourful and well kempt library. "Where am I?" The next thing that greeted my sight was a purple pony.
"Hey! You're a human aren't you?" The pony seemed to be torn between mild irritation and intrigue.
"Yeah... I'm a human... WAIT WHAT?!"
That was the first time I met Twilight Sparkle, a unicorn pony in the land of Equestria. I know I know, it sounds pretty far fetched. I probably wouldn't believe it myself if I didn't keep a memento of my time in Equestria. Twilight had been asked by one of their rulers, Princess Celestia, to summon up what she referred to as the 'best defense attorney in Equestria'. Her friend, a pegasus pony named Rainbow Dash, had been accused of murdering another pegasus prior to a race. While the princess and the rest of Dash's friends had full confidence that she was innocent, Celestia excused herself from the trial to avoid a conflict of interest. The judge from my world was even brought over to preside over the courtroom. I was called on to face off against an old adversary of Twilight's, one Trixie Lulamoon...
"The GREAT and POWERFUL Trixie would like to start off by saying the defense has no chance of winning in this. Zero. Zilch. Nada. None!" Trixie thrust her nose high into the air as she laid out the challenge. It didn't take me long to come to the conclusion that the light blue braggart was going to cause me multiple headaches in the coming days.
"What kind of opening statement is that?!" I instantly regretted taking the bait.
"In fact, Trixie is insulted she is not given a proper attorney to wage battle with. Instead she is forced to deal with this idiot." If a person or pony could be more smug...
"What's your problem!"
"Er-hem!" The judge actually seemed to be on my side for once. "Please refrain from personal attacks on the defense Ms. Trixie. Can you please just get on with stating your case?"
Thus began Turnabout Storm, my most bizarre case up to that point. Rainbow Dash was set to take part in a flying race near their home in Ponyville, when she was approached by the victim with embarrassing pictures to blackmail her into dropping out. He was later found dead where the pair had met, and suspicion naturally landed on her. Through the case I deduced that the victim, Ace Swift, had been blackmailing stronger competitors for years with the assistance of his manager, Sonata, who bore a striking resemblance to my old mentor, Mia Fey. I was able to successfully divert suspicion from Dash to Sonata, only to figure out in the end his death was an accident and not caused by either of the accused mares. Trixie had been maliciously trying to convict Dash throughout the trial in order to get back at Twilight for a perceived slight from their past. While she was initially downtrodden afterwards, I was able to spend some time with her following the trial and found she's not a bad person, well pony. I had hoped she would do well for herself in the years since I last saw her. I was about to find out firsthand what it's like to be on the outside looking in.
Soon after my return to my own world, I was asked to defend a magician, Zak Gramarye. He had been accused of killing his ailing mentor. The case that cost me my attorney's badge...
"...Finally. You just couldn't resist, could you, Herr Wright?" Klavier Gavin, the prosecutor facing off against me and front man for his band, The Gavinners, slammed his fist against the wall and gave me a look that was equal parts triumph and disgust.
"Resist what? Presenting solid evidence?" The hairs on the back of my neck started to raise... something was not right.
"Might I request we put the current cross-examination on hold? The prosecution would like to call a new witness." Klavier was scowling.
Klavier called up Drew Misham, an artist who had begun to dabble in forgeries. It was actually his daughter that produced the forged page that I presented, but the result was the same. Gavin had inside information that the piece of paper I was to produce in court that day was a fake, given to me only moments before by a young naive Trucy. His brother, Kristoph, had it produced when he thought he was going to defend Mr. Gramarye. When Zak chose me instead, Kristoph used it as a means to have me humiliated and disbarred. Before the trial ended and he could be pronounced guily, Zak Gramarye disappeared and thus the trial was never concluded. I lost my badge, his daughter came to live with me, the Earth kept spinning. I spent the next 7 years piecing together the case, learning exactly how events had led to my disbarment, including a reunion with Zak before his untimely death at the hands of Kristoph, as well as the death of Mr. Misham by the same.
After introducing the jurist system, and finally uncovering the truth over the forged evidence, I retook the bar and became a defense attorney again. Trucy has grown up to be a fine young woman, Apollo Justice has been following in my footsteps, and we've added a new attorney recently to the team- Athena Cykes, a specialist in analytical psychology. So why am I telling you all of this? Well, for the longest time I thought the two cases entirely unrelated. A strange case in the world of ponies, and a dark and troubling case that cost me my badge. What could the two possibly have in common? I was about to find out that there was more to it than I had anticipated, and a decade of questions and confusion was about to rear its' ugly head.
